I think the difference is that the silent treatment is oft used as punishment by the person doing it. You said/did something that upset them therefore you deserve to be punished by not being able to speak to them anymore. It's usually done without informing the recipient when they will be ready to talk again.
While communicating that you need time to yourself to think through your emotions before you are ready to talk is something done out of want for conflict resolution. If this is how you react to arguments and you communicate that, then that is completely fine.
The issue arises when you use the possibility of conflict resolution to emotionally manipulate and hurt your partner.
Additionally, I think the length of time you take after asking for space comes into play. I don't like to police how people react to their emotions, but not talking to your partner for 13 hours straight because of a joke that most people wouldn't even blink an eye at is extreme and shows a level of emotional immaturity. Usually, when someone states they need time to themselves before they can talk, it isn't followed with 13 hours of silence with no end in sight. The biggest difference between the two is the communication(or lack of) that its happening and then what happens to the other person while it’s happening. Communicating that you need to step away because you are upset or communicating that you need some space and a general approximation for how long is different from the silent treatment because the person isn’t left in the dark. The silent treatment is more like withdrawing connection because you’re angry or hurt, and then leaving the other person to figure out what they did and how to get you to engage again. It functions more as punishment and abandonment rather than self regulation.
